Finance Solar giant Suntech defaults but local players say market thinning a good development Patrick Stafford March 19, 2013
Technology Look out TV, YouTube has figured out how to make money: Kohler James Thomson December 9, 2009
Technology YouTube executive says SMEs need to connect with consumers through video Patrick Stafford December 8, 2009